Analysis

In 2024, ict goods imports in Sub-Saharan Africa (excluding high income) stood at 4.2%.

Compared with earlier readings it is up 11.6% on the previous year and down 7.3% over ten years.

Over the whole period, ict goods imports in Sub-Saharan Africa (excluding high income) peaked at 7.2% in 2004 and was at its lowest, 3.8%, in 2022.

That places Sub-Saharan Africa (excluding high income) 36th out of 47 groups with data for 2024, putting it in the bottom quarter.

The long-run direction has been consistently falling across the 25 years of available data.

ICT goods imports in Sub-Saharan Africa (excluding high income), year by year

Annual values for ICT goods imports (% total goods imports) in Sub-Saharan Africa (excluding high income), 2000 to 2024.
Year % total goods imports Change
2000 6.7%
2001 6.4% -3.6%
2002 6.3% -2.5%
2003 6.4% +1.3%
2004 7.2% +13.7%
2005 7.0% -3.4%
2006 6.6% -5.2%
2007 5.6% -15.8%
2008 5.9% +5.6%
2009 5.9% +0.6%
2010 6.0% +0.9%
2011 4.9% -18.1%
2012 4.8% -3.0%
2013 4.5% -6.4%
2014 4.5% +2.1%
2015 5.1% +11.8%
2016 4.9% -3.3%
2017 4.4% -9.6%
2018 4.2% -5.7%
2019 4.4% +4.7%
2020 4.5% +3.2%
2021 4.1% -8.6%
2022 3.8% -9.2%
2023 3.8% +0.5%
2024 4.2% +11.6%

Information and communication technology goods imports include computers and peripheral equipment, communication equipment, consumer electronic equipment, electronic components, and other information and technology goods (miscellaneous).
